Course Detail
| Course Title | Operating Systems | 
| Course Code | ICCS 222 | 
| Credit | 4 | 
| Semester Offered | 1, 2, 3 | 
| Duration of Courses | |
| Degree | Undergraduate | 
| Programme | Bachelor of Science in Computer Science (International Program) | 
| Course Description | Definition of functions and components of operating systems; survey of contemporary multiprocessing / multiprogramming systems; exploration of systems programs: their design, internal structure and implementation; CPU scheduling, hierarchical and virtual memory management; advanced topics in operating systems, performance measurement and evaluation and design of operating system modules. | 
| Prerequisite | ICCS 200 | 
| Other Description | |
| Language of Instruction | 
